Greenville Police Department, South Carolina
End of Watch Wednesday, April 13, 1904
Add to My HeroesJames Patrick Tucker
Police Officer James Tucker was shot and killed while attempting to arrest a drunk railroad watchman on King Street.
The suspect also wounded another officer before being shot and killed by the officer.
Officer Tucker had served with the Greenville Police Department for 16 years.
